7.4. USER INTERFACE CONNECTION
²
Up to 200m, with the same shielded cable,
two communication boards (optional) have
to be added at controller and display sides to
relay the signal.
The semi-graphic terminal is connected to the controller using the supplied 80cm telephone cable between
the back of the terminal and the J10 plug of the controller.
For other applications, it is possible to extend the distance between the terminal and the controller:
²
Up to 50m using a 6-wire shielded telephone-type cable, 2 telephone 6-pin connectors (straight pin
to pin connection) and 2 ferrites mounted on the telephone cable, one on the terminal side and the
other on the controller side. The shield has to be connected to the GND pin of J11.
